The public schools with the highest share of Hispanic students in Latah County, Idaho
This ranking covers the public schools with the highest share of Hispanic students in Latah County, Idaho, drawn from 16 qualifying public schools. PALOUSE PRAIRIE CHARTER SCHOOL leads the list at 9.2%, against a median of 5.0% across the ranked schools.

| # | School | City | % Hispanic |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| PALOUSE PRAIRIE CHARTER SCHOOL | MOSCOW, ID | 9.2%(17) |
| 2 | POTLATCH ELEMENTARY SCHOOL | POTLATCH, ID | 7.1%(17) |
| 3 | GENESEE SCHOOL | GENESEE, ID | 6.3%(18) |
| 4 | LENA WHITMORE ELEMENTARY SCHOOL | MOSCOW, ID | 6.0%(15) |
| 5 | POTLATCH JR/SR HIGH SCHOOL | POTLATCH, ID | 5.7%(12) |
| 6 | MOSCOW HIGH SCHOOL | MOSCOW, ID | 5.7%(43) |
| 7 | TROY ELEMENTARY SCHOOL | TROY, ID | 5.4%(10) |
| 8 | MOSCOW MIDDLE SCHOOL | MOSCOW, ID | 5.4%(27) |
| 9 | TROY JR/SR HIGH SCHOOL | TROY, ID | 4.6%(7) |
| 10 | MOSCOW CHARTER SCHOOL | MOSCOW, ID | 4.3%(8) |
| 11 | A B MCDONALD ELEMENTARY SCHOOL | MOSCOW, ID | 4.1%(14) |
| 12 | WEST PARK ELEMENTARY SCHOOL | MOSCOW, ID | 3.8%(9) |
| 13 | J RUSSELL ELEMENTARY SCHOOL | MOSCOW, ID | 3.6% |
| 14 | KENDRICK JR/SR HIGH SCHOOL | KENDRICK, ID | 2.3%(3) |
| 15 | JULIAETTA ELEMENTARY SCHOOL | JULIAETTA, ID | 1.5%(2) |
| 16 | DEARY SCHOOL | DEARY, ID | 0.7%(1) |
